The Typhlosion (17) (#017/111, Neo Genesis) is a holo rare Pokemon card. Across 3 ZeroPop community scans it averages a 7.3/10 grade (NM), with 0% grading Gem Mint 9.5 or higher. Its current raw market value is about $171.
